Position Summary:
Working with the Aviation leadership to include the Chief/Assistant Chief Instructors, Operations Manager, Student Control and others, the Flight Line Scheduler is responsible for assigning aircraft to instructor/students based on required equipment, availability, flight priority, and aircraft maintenance status. This involves timely and efficient scheduling of students and instructors in coordination with the Assistant/Chief Instructor Pilot. In addition, the FLS will coordinate and schedule all required FAA check rides, which requires communication/scheduling with appropriate Designated Pilot Examiners (DPEs) to ensure student progress and completion of required FAA check rides. The FLS manages student instructor assignments, maintaining a prioritized list of waiting students.
